Commit 0f275925e682467fea80a835a9491892f9fe1563

Authored by alex
1 parent 16280df6

Подлатал imagemanager + отображение alt и title в blog/index

backend/views/layouts/menu_items.php
@@ -34,7 +34,7 @@ @@ -34,7 +34,7 @@
34 'label' => \Yii::t('core', 'Image manager'), 34 'label' => \Yii::t('core', 'Image manager'),
35 'url' => [ 'imagemanager' ], 35 'url' => [ 'imagemanager' ],
36 'icon' => 'image', 36 'icon' => 'image',
37 - 'template' => '<a href="imagemanager"><b class="static"></b><span>{label}</span>{badge}</a>', 37 + 'template' => '<a href="/admin/imagemanager"><b class="static"></b><span>{label}</span>{badge}</a>',
38 ], 38 ],
39 [ 39 [
40 'label' => \Yii::t('core', 'Pages'), 40 'label' => \Yii::t('core', 'Pages'),
common/config/main.php
@@ -10,18 +10,17 @@ @@ -10,18 +10,17 @@
10 ], 10 ],
11 'vendorPath' => dirname(dirname(__DIR__)) . '/vendor', 11 'vendorPath' => dirname(dirname(__DIR__)) . '/vendor',
12 'modules' => [ 12 'modules' => [
13 - # ctrl-c/ctrl-v из garant-service  
14 - 'imagemanager' => [  
15 - 'class' => 'backend\components\imagemanager\Module',  
16 - 'canUploadImage' => true,  
17 - 'canRemoveImage' => function () {  
18 - return true;  
19 - },  
20 - 'setBlameableBehavior' => false,  
21 - 'cssFiles' => [  
22 - 'https://cdnjs.cloudflare.com/ajax/libs/font-awesome/4.6.3/css/font-awesome.min.css',  
23 - ],  
24 -], 13 + 'imagemanager' => [
  14 + 'class' => 'artbox\core\components\imagemanager\Module',
  15 + 'canUploadImage' => true,
  16 + 'canRemoveImage' => function () {
  17 + return true;
  18 + },
  19 + 'setBlameableBehavior' => false,
  20 + 'cssFiles' => [
  21 + 'https://cdnjs.cloudflare.com/ajax/libs/font-awesome/4.6.3/css/font-awesome.min.css',
  22 + ],
  23 + ],
25 'rating' => [ 24 'rating' => [
26 'class' => Module::className() 25 'class' => Module::className()
27 ], 26 ],
frontend/views/blog/_article.php
@@ -13,10 +13,16 @@ @@ -13,10 +13,16 @@
13 <div class="img-blog-list"> 13 <div class="img-blog-list">
14 <a href="<?=Url::to(['alias' => $model->language->alias])?>"> 14 <a href="<?=Url::to(['alias' => $model->language->alias])?>">
15 <!--360x240--> 15 <!--360x240-->
  16 +
  17 + <?php
  18 + $alt=(isset($model->image->lang->attributes['alt']))?$model->image->lang->attributes['alt']:'';
  19 + $description=(isset($model->image->lang->attributes['description']))?$model->image->lang->attributes['description']:'';
  20 +
  21 + ?>
16 <?=ImageHelper::set(($model->image) ? $model->image->getPath() : null) 22 <?=ImageHelper::set(($model->image) ? $model->image->getPath() : null)
17 ->cropResize(360, 240) 23 ->cropResize(360, 240)
18 ->quality(84) 24 ->quality(84)
19 - ->renderImage()?> 25 + ->renderImage(['alt'=>$alt,'description'=>$description])?>
20 </a> 26 </a>
21 </div> 27 </div>
22 <div class="blog-all-date-views"> 28 <div class="blog-all-date-views">